Pokhari

Pokhari is a village located in Imamganj subdivision of Gaya district in Bihar, India. It is situated 11km away from sub-district headquarter Imamganj (tehsildar office) and 80km away from district headquarter Gaya. As per 2009 stats, Manjhauli is the gram panchayat of Pokhari village.

About Pokhari

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Pokhari is 255981. The village spans a total geographical area of 325 hectares. Sherghati is nearest town to Pokhari village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 45km away.

Population of Pokhari

According to the 2011 Census, Pokhari has a total population of about 2,008, with approximately 1,037 males and 971 females. The sex ratio is around 936 females per 1,000 males. Children aged 0 to 6 years make up about 346 of the population, showing the young generation present in the village. There are about 780 members of the Scheduled Castes (SC), an important community in the village. Information about the Scheduled Tribes (ST) population is not available. The overall literacy rate is approximately 41.04%, with male literacy at about 50.14% and female literacy near 31.31%. There are around 324 households in the village. Connectivity of Pokhari

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Pokhari. As per the 2011 stats, Pokhari had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within 5 - 10 km distance
Private Bus Service Available within 10+ km distance
Railway Station Available within 10+ km distance
